黑狐家游戏

关系数据库能够实现的三种基本运算,数据库原理之关系数据库关系运算

欧气 4 0

标题:探索关系数据库的三种基本运算

一、引言

关系数据库是一种广泛应用于数据管理和处理的技术,它基于关系模型,通过关系运算来实现对数据的操作和查询,关系数据库的三种基本运算——选择、投影和连接,是构建复杂查询和处理数据的基础,本文将详细介绍这三种基本运算,并探讨它们在关系数据库中的重要性和应用。

二、关系数据库的基本概念

在深入了解三种基本运算之前,我们先来回顾一下关系数据库的一些基本概念。

关系数据库是由一组关系组成的,每个关系都可以看作是一张二维表,关系表中的行表示实体,列表示实体的属性,关系数据库通过关系运算来对这些关系进行操作和查询,以获取所需的数据。

三、三种基本运算

1、选择运算(Selection):选择运算用于从关系中筛选出满足特定条件的行,它根据给定的条件,从关系中选择出符合条件的行,并返回一个新的关系,选择运算可以通过使用条件表达式来实现。

2、投影运算(Projection):投影运算用于从关系中选择出指定的列,并返回一个新的关系,它根据给定的列名列表,从关系中选择出这些列,并返回一个新的关系,投影运算可以通过使用列名列表来实现。

3、连接运算(Joining):连接运算用于将两个或多个关系根据指定的条件进行合并,生成一个新的关系,它可以根据关系中的公共属性将两个关系进行匹配,并将匹配的行合并成一个新的关系,连接运算可以通过使用连接条件来实现。

四、三种基本运算的应用

1、数据查询:选择运算和投影运算常用于数据查询中,通过使用选择运算,可以从关系中筛选出满足特定条件的行,从而获取所需的数据,通过使用投影运算,可以从关系中选择出指定的列,从而获取所需的信息。

2、数据更新:连接运算常用于数据更新中,通过使用连接运算,可以将两个或多个关系根据指定的条件进行合并,从而更新关系中的数据。

3、数据分析:三种基本运算可以组合使用,以进行复杂的数据分析,通过使用选择运算、投影运算和连接运算的组合,可以从关系中获取所需的数据,并进行各种数据分析和处理。

五、结论

关系数据库的三种基本运算——选择、投影和连接,是构建复杂查询和处理数据的基础,它们在关系数据库中具有重要的地位和作用,可以帮助用户从关系中获取所需的数据,并进行各种数据分析和处理,在实际应用中,用户可以根据具体的需求,灵活使用这三种基本运算,以实现高效的数据管理和处理。

标签: #关系数据库 #基本运算 #数据库原理 #关系运算

黑狐家游戏
  • 评论列表

留言评论